服务器调数据卡顿?
500
2024-04-27
1、专用服务器数据库服务器要求每个用户拥有一个专用服务器进程,当用户比较多的时候,则其对服务器的硬件资源,特别是内存,会产生比较大的压力。适用环境:1、只有少数客户端。
2、为数据仓库搭建的数据库系统。
3、联机事务处理系统。(大事务的处理,若使用共享服务器模式,很有可能会造成有些事务需要进入队列排队,响应时间拉长)2、共享服务器进程多个用户程序可以并发共用一个服务器进程,客户端程序通过调用调度程序与服务器进程相连如何查看是否是共享服务器模式?1查看调度程序SQL>showparameterdispatchers;NAMETYPEVALUE----------------------------------------------------------------------------dispatchersstring(PROTOCOL=TCP)(SERVICE=sdecpyXDB)max_dispatchersinteger5mts_dispatchersstring(PROTOCOL=TCP)(SERVICE=sdecpyXDB)mts_max_dispatchersinteger52、查看共享服务器进程数SQL>showparametershared_servers;NAMETYPEVALUE----------------------------------------------------------------------------max_shared_serversinteger20shared_serversinteger13、预留SQL>showparametershared_server_session;NAMETYPEVALUE--------------------------------------------------------shared_server_sessionsinteger165其中dispatchers:调度程序服务器进程max_shared_servers:指定同时运行的最大服务器进程数shared_servers:启动实例时可以创建的服务器进程数shared_server_sessions:指定用于用户会话的总数,配置此参数可为专用服务器保留用户会话4.改变进程数SQL>altersystemsetshared_servers=2;系统已更改。SQL>showparametershared_servers;NAMETYPEVALUE------------------------------------------------------------------------max_shared_serversinteger20shared_serversinteger2SQL>优点是客户端进程多对一,增加了数据库可以支持的用户数。缺点就是各个用户共享一个进程,对用户访问数据库的性能有所影响。
应该是DBMS的服务名把,因为有允许多重驻留的,有多个服务名1.查看oracle的安装目录,方法是查看注册表:如:H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\ORACLE_HOME REG_SZ E:\ORACLE\ORA92 得到了oracle的安装目录一般来讲,如果服务器在安装时采用的是默认值那么这个值是:
D:\ORACLE\ORA922.找到tnsnames.ora文件在根目录下面找到\network\ADMIN\tnsnames.ora 文件,并打开3.仔细查看里面的tnsnames.ora 配置例如# TNSNAMES.ORA Network Configuration File: d:\oracle\ora92\network\admin\tnsnames.ora# Generated by Oracle configuration tools.WZZ=(D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= wzz)(PORT = 1521)) )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= WZZ) ))其中的service_name就是服务名,例如对如上面的文件 ,服务名就是WZZ附 C#获取oracle服务器名 :
#region 从注册表中读取安装主目录的值 /// <summary> /// 从注册表中读取安装主目录的值 /// </summary> /// <param name="setupKey"></param> /// <returns></returns> public static string ReadHomeDirectory(string setupKey) { RegistryKey readKey; try { readKey = Registry.LocalMachine.OpenSubKey ("Software\\ORACLE", false)
; foreach (string name in readKey.GetValueNames()) { if (name == setupKey) { return readKey.GetValue(name).ToString(); } } return null; } catch { return null; } } #endregion
这个要自己对着安装程序的图形化界面摸索一下,要有信心,并不复杂。
oracle监听器配置(listener):
选中树形目录中监听程序项,再点击左上侧“+”按钮添加监听程序,点击监听程序目录,默认新加的监听器名称是listener(该名称也可以由任意合法字符命名)。选中该名称,选中窗口右侧栏下拉选项中的“监听位置”,点击添加地址按钮。在出现的网络地址栏的协议下拉选项中选中
“tcp/ip”,主机文本框中输入主机名称或ip地址(如果主机即用作服务端也作为客户端,输入两项之一均有效;如果主机作为服务端并需要通过网络连
接,建议输入ip地址),端口文本框中输入数字端口,默认是1521,也可以自定义任意有效数字端口。
选中窗口右侧栏下拉选项中的“数据库服务”,点击添加数据库按钮。在出现的数据库栏中输入全局数据库名,如myoracle。注意这里的全局数据库名与数据
库sid有所区别,全局数据库名实际通过域名来控制在同一网段内数据库全局命名的唯一性,就如windows下的域名控制器,如这里可以输入
myoracle.192.168.1.5。oracle主目录可以不填写,输入sid,如myoracle。
保存以上配置,默认即可在oracle安装目录下找到监听配置文件
(windows下如d:\oracle\ora92\network\admin\listener.ora,linux/unix下$
oracle_home/network/admin/listerer.ora)。
至此,oracle服务端监听器配置已经完成。
要检查本地是否安装了Oracle服务器,可以执行以下步骤:
1. 打开任务管理器(在Windows操作系统中)。
2. 点击"进程"选项卡。
3. 如果有显示"oracle.exe",这意味着本机已经安装了Oracle数据库。
4. 另一种方法是,在命令提示符(或DOS命令行)下输入以下命令:telnet 127.0.0.1 1521。如果连接成功,表示Oracle服务正在运行。
5. 还可以在控制面板的"安装卸载"部分查看是否存在Oracle服务。
然而,请注意,如果你只使用SQLplus或Java的JDBC进行开发,且不需要使用其他第三方客户端访问Oracle数据库,那么即使没有安装Oracle客户端,你仍然可以访问和利用Oracle数据库的功能。但是,为了方便使用,安装Oracle客户端仍然是推荐的选择。
总的来说,如果你在本地的计算机上成功地安装了Oracle数据库并启动了服务,那么你应该可以在任务管理器中看到"oracle.exe"进程,同时通过telnet命令连接到本地Oracle服务器的默认端口1521。
本地服务器连接oracle方法如下:
1.
先写好驱动字符串,连接字符串,用户名和密码字符串。 localhost 是本地地址 1521 是Oracle 默认端口 orcl 是Oracle 默认名称 uname 和 pwd 是 Oracle的用户名和密码
2.
加载驱动 Class.forName(driverStr);
3.
获取连接 conn=DriverManager.getConnection(orclStr,uname,pwd);
4.
然后就可以进行数据库的操作。
共享餐厅的经营模式为:顾客在某餐厅没有排上号,就可以去共享餐厅点单,配送人员会去相应的餐厅取餐,顾客不用排队也能吃到喜欢的饭菜。
共享餐厅它只提供一个食用场景,和商品配送服务,自身并不需要厨房。
共享餐厅运营方还能向附近入驻的商家,收取一定的抽点费。
随 Oracle9i 一同推出的 Oracle RAC 是 Oracle 并行服务器 (OPS) 的后续版本。RAC 允许多个实例同时访问同一数据库(存储器)。它通过允许系统进行扩展,提供了容错、负载均衡和性能效益,同时由于所有节点访问同一数据库,因此一个实例的故障不会导致无法访问数据库。 Oracle RAC 的核心是共享磁盘子系统。集群中的所有节点必须能够访问集群中所有节点的所有数据、重做日志文件、控制文件和参数文件。数据磁盘必须在全局范围内可用,以便允许所有节点访问数据库。每个节点拥有自己的重做日志和控制文件,但是其他节点必须能够访问这些文件,以便在系统故障时恢复该节点。 Oracle RAC 与 OPS 之间的一个较大区别是,它采用了高速缓存合并技术。在 OPS 中,节点间的数据请求需要先将数据写入磁盘,然后发出请求的节点才可以读取该数据。在 RAC 中,数据是带锁传递的。 不是所有的集群解决方案都使用共享存储器。有些厂商使用一种称为联合集群的方法,在这种方法中,数据在数台机器中分布,而不是由所有机器共享。但是,在使用 Oracle RAC 10g 时,多个节点使用相同的磁盘集来存储数据。利用Oracle RAC,数据文件、重做日志文件、控制文件和归档日志文件保存在原始磁盘设备的共享存储器、NAS、SAN、ASM 或集群文件系统中。Oracle 的集群方法利用了集群中所有节点的集体处理能力,同时提供了故障切换安全性。转载,仅供参考。
电脑全部连接到网络``` 路由器设置的IP最好是静态的~~ 比如路由统一设置IP为 192.168.1.(1-255) 服务器比如就设置192.168.1.2 然后在服务器上把要共享的文件夹共享就可以了`` 再去别的电脑上 在运行里面 输入 \\192.168.1.2 (这个是服务器的IP)就可以看到你设置共享过的文件夹了~~~
随着科技的不断进步,物联网技术在各个领域的应用日益广泛,而物联网共享模式作为其中的重要组成部分,正逐渐成为商业和生活的新风向。
物联网共享模式是指利用物联网技术,通过连接各种设备和资源,实现共享和协同的商业模式。这种模式通过提高资源利用率、降低成本、优化服务而带来了巨大的经济效益。
在当前的社会中,物联网共享模式已经广泛应用于多个领域,如共享单车、共享充电宝、共享办公空间等。通过物联网技术的支持,这些共享业务得以实现高效、便捷的运营,为用户提供了全新的体验。
随着技术的不断进步和用户需求的不断变化,物联网共享模式也在不断向着智能化、个性化的方向发展。未来,随着5G技术的普及和人工智能的应用,物联网共享模式将会在更多的领域得到应用。
总的来说,物联网共享模式作为物联网技术的一种重要应用形式,对于推动经济发展、提升用户体验都具有重要意义。随着技术的不断进步和商业模式的不断创新,相信物联网共享模式会在未来展现出更加美好的发展前景。
在今天的互联网时代,共享服务器成为了许多个人和小型企业选择的首选。共享服务器的概念是指多个网站共同使用同一台物理服务器的资源,这意味着服务器的硬件和软件资源被多个用户共享。这种共享的方式给用户带来了许多优势,但同时也存在一些不足之处。
共享服务器的最大优势在于价格的便宜和灵活性的高。相比于独立服务器,共享服务器的成本要低得多,这对于预算有限的个人和小型企业而言是非常诱人的选择。此外,共享服务器还可以根据用户的需求进行灵活的升级和扩展,使用户能够根据业务需求快速调整服务器资源,而无需担心硬件和软件的管理问题。
另一个共享服务器的优势是维护和管理的便捷性。对于那些没有技术背景的用户来说,使用共享服务器可以免去繁琐的维护工作,所有的技术细节都由服务器提供商负责。这意味着用户可以将精力集中在自己的网站内容和业务上,而无需花费时间和精力去学习和管理服务器。
然而,共享服务器也存在一些不足之处需要用户注意。首先是资源的共享可能会导致性能问题。由于多个网站共享同一台服务器的资源,当某个网站流量激增或者出现其他资源消耗过大的情况时,可能会对其他网站的性能产生影响。这意味着用户的网站可能会因为其他网站的影响而变得缓慢或不可用。
其次,共享服务器的安全性相对较低。由于多个用户共同使用同一台服务器,一旦有一个用户的网站遭到黑客攻击或者感染恶意软件,其他用户的网站也有可能受到影响。这意味着共享服务器的用户需要额外关注网站的安全性,以防止他人的行为对自己产生负面影响。
为了充分利用共享服务器的优势,并最大化其性能和安全性,用户可以采取以下措施:
综上所述,在选择共享服务器时,用户既要考虑到其价格低廉和便捷性高的特点,又要认识到可能存在的性能问题和安全风险。共享服务器适合那些预算有限,无需高性能和高安全性要求的个人和小型企业。如果您的网站有着大量流量、对数据安全性要求较高或需要高性能服务器,那么独立服务器可能更适合您。最终,选择共享服务器还是独立服务器是根据个人需求和预算来决定的。